Patterns

2N IT Patterns is a collection of patterns and best practices for software development agreed upon after internal discussions.

Installation

Install the gem and add to the application's Gemfile by executing:

$ bundle add 2n-patterns

If bundler is not being used to manage dependencies, install the gem by executing:

$ gem install 2n-patterns

Development

bundle for installing stuff. If you want to run all automated tests at once, do bench test/automated/ or run specific tests regular ruby path/to/file

To install this gem onto your local machine, run bundle exec rake install. To release a new version, update the version number in version.rb and gemspec, and then run bundle exec rake release, which will create a git tag for the version, push git commits and the created tag, and push the .gem file to rubygems.org.
